    Compared to the alpha bravo series, the alpha series bags have better functionality in terms of pocket sizing and orientation. The exterior pockets of the alpha brief pack is three dimensional, which means that those pockets would not take away interior space when they are stuffed. The alpha bravo series, on the other hand, has a more streamlined look but those pockets have no dimensions at all and become useless when the main compartment is packed.

    I really like this backpack! I really enjoy your videos! I think this backpack is great in every aspect, but there’s one small issue: the pockets at the front, especially the lower one, have openings that are too small. This limits the size of the items you can put inside, and if the opening were just a bit bigger, there would be enough space for larger items. Additionally, it’s harder to see the items inside because the opening is so small. I really hope Tumi’s next-generation product, the Alpha 4, can solve this problem. Based on the update cycle from Alpha 2 to Alpha 3, Alpha 4 should be coming soon, but so far there’s no news, and it seems they’re not planning to release it in 2025. Also, since the pocket layout hasn’t changed in the ten years since Alpha 2, I’m still worried whether the next generation will be willing to make changes... So, I feel conflicted. Right now, the best product is definitely the Alpha X, as it’s the best in its category, but the small pocket openings slightly affect its potential to be the perfect, flawless backpack.
